Who we are:
M-Files is redefining how work gets done. Our context-first document management system offers purpose-built business use cases—spanning universal and industry-specific workflows—to enable secure collaboration, automate processes, and ensure governance.
Unlike traditional systems, M-Files organizes content around the context of your business, connecting documents to related people, projects, and transactions. With our unique metadata-driven architecture, organizations can model content in line with their business processes, unify information across silos, and apply AI at scale. The result is greater productivity, reduced risk, and smarter, faster decisions for over 6,000 customers in 100+ countries.

Summary of the role:
A Partner Operations Manager is a strategic and operational leader responsible for optimizing the performance of the Partner Sales Organization. This role bridges the gap between strategy and execution by streamlining processes, managing tools and data, and enabling the partner team to operate efficiently and effectively.
What you will be doing/Responsibilities and Duties:
- Partner with the Sales Executive responsible for delivering the partner revenue targets including forecast and QBR structure and cadence.
- Lead the design and execution of scalable partner processes and workflows.
- Develop and maintain AI forward and agentic systems, process and reporting.
- Manage CRM and Partner systems and ensure data integrity, accuracy, and usability, including compliance and audit readiness across partner-reported data.
- Support the development and execution of the partner program, partner business plan review, MDF management, partner agreements, and overall partner governance.
- Define and implement partner territory planning, quota setting, and compensation models.
- Partner with stakeholders in all aspects of the business both in home and partner only markets.
- Identify and implement process improvements to enhance partner and partner sales productivity.
- Collaborate with Deal Desk and Marketing Ops to streamline Lead to PO processes, including deal registration and conflict resolution.
- Provide insights and recommendations based on sales data and trends.
- Support partner recruitment, onboarding, scorecarding, and training of partners and partner sales team members as needed.
- Ensure alignment between GTM strategy and operational execution.
